Skip to main content


Located along the impressive Amur River in Eastern Russia, on the border of Russia and China, Khabarovsk is an unexpected surprise of a city after miles and miles of snowy forest to the west. The city boasts pretty, tree-lined boulevards, a beautiful and well-developed riverside park and an expansive beach popular during the mild summer months. During the winter, don’t miss the spectacular ice sculpture display in central pl Lenina – a dazzling scene that draws visitors from miles aroun